contiv-stn

command
v0.0.0-...-2d08fe4 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Dec 20, 2023 License: Apache-2.0 Imports: 16 Imported by: 0

Documentation

Overview

Contiv-stn is a Daemon which acts as a GRPC server, serving "Steal the NIC" requests - requests to unbind an interface from the kernel driver.

Before processing such a request, it remembers the old config, so that it is able to revert to the previous state later. Once the interface is unconfigured, STN Daemon starts watching contiv-vpp health check probe (after the initial timeout). In case that the contiv-vpp is not responding, the STN Daemon reverts the interface back to the original state: unbinds the interface form the current driver and binds it to the original kernel driver, configures back the original IPs and routes that were pointing to that interface.

STN Daemon is designed to run in its own Docker container, running under plain Docker, so that it is independent of the k8s cluster infrastructure.

Directories

Path Synopsis
model
stn

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L